Wood cladding installation in Marysville, WA, is a popular choice for homeowners looking to enhance the aesthetic appeal and durability of their homes. The cost of this project can vary significantly based on several factors, including the type of wood, labor charges, and additional services required. Understanding these factors can help you budget more eff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Wood: Different wood species have varying costs. Cedar and redwood are typically more expensive than pine or fir.
- Labor Charges: The cost of labor can vary depending on the experience and reputation of the contractor.
- Size of the Project: Larger projects will naturally require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Preparation Work: Any necessary preparation work, such as removing old cladding or repairing the underlying structure, will add to the cost.
- Finish and Treatment: Adding finishes or treatments, like staining or sealing, can increase the price.
- Complexity of Design: Intricate designs or custom work will generally be more expensive than standard installations.
- Location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as can increase labor time and c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Marysville, WA) |
---|---|
Basic Wood Cladding Installation (per sq. ft.) | $5 - $10 |
Premium Wood Cladding (per sq. ft.) | $15 - $25 |
Labor Costs (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Removal of Old Cladding (per sq. ft.) | $2 - $4 |
Surface Preparation (per sq. ft.) | $1 - $3 |
Staining or Sealing (per sq. ft.) | $1.50 - $3 |
Custom Design Work (per hour) | $75 - $100 |
